About this listen

Abigail, a children's book author haunted by past traumas, returns to her childhood home to care for her ailing father, who is suffering from Alzheimer's.

Shortly after her arrival, she is thrust into a nightmarish reality as she uncovers chilling family secrets.

Her journey becomes an intense battle for sanity, pulling her into a confrontation with her deepest fears and long-buried traumas. As she pieces together the past, she realizes her family's legacy is entwined with something far more sinister, leaving her to question what's real and what lies in the shadows of her mind.

This isn't a story about monsters in the closet. It's about the ones that linger behind your eyelids when you're too terrified to sleep. Within her father's unraveling mind and the suffocating walls of her childhood home, she senses something rotting, something watching. Each sleepless night pulls her deeper into a fractured reality where memory and hallucination blur, unearthing horrors that refuse to stay buried.

Relentlessly unsettling, Purgatory is a horror story without mercy—an exploration of memory, identity, and the terrifying possibility that once you've crossed certain lines, there's no coming back. The end of daze.
